Elasticsearch text aggregation
WebMar 28, 2024 · What is an Elasticsearch aggregation? The aggregations framework is a powerful tool built in every Elasticsearch deployment. In Elasticsearch, an … WebElasticsearch organizes aggregations into three categories: Metric aggregations that calculate metrics, such as a sum or average, from field values. Bucket aggregations …
Elasticsearch text aggregation
Did you know?
WebJul 8, 2024 · Aggregation Because ElasticSearch is concerned with performance, there are some rules on what kind of fields you can aggregate. You can group by any numeric field but for text fields that have to be of type keyword or have fielddata=true. You can think of keyword as being like an index. WebApr 2, 2024 · Improving aggregation performance in Elasticsearch. Even though Elasticsearch is most known for its full text search capabilities, many use cases also …
WebOct 25, 2024 · "aggregations" : { "my_sample" : { "sampler" : {"shard_size" : shard_size}, "aggregations": { "keywords" : { "significant_text" : { "size": size, "field" : field, alg: {} } } } } } } return [row ['key'] for row in …
WebJul 7, 2024 · Thanks. You can sort the terms agg by the value of a sub-agg but there isn't an agg that'll get you the unique name. If you do the terms aggregation on the name it'll be sorted by the name by default. You could get the group_id from the top_hits, I think. You'd probably be better off paginating using the composite agg. WebAggregations Aggregations on text fields. By default, Elasticsearch doesn’t support aggregations on a text field. Because text fields... General aggregation structure. If …
WebMay 18, 2016 · Although SQL Server's Full-Text search is good for searching text that is within a database, there are better ways of implementing search if the text is less-well structured, or comes from a wide variety of sources or formats. Ryszard takes ElasticSearch, and seven million questions from StackOverflow, in order to show you …
WebA multi-bucket aggregation that groups semi-structured text into buckets. Each text field is re-analyzed using a custom analyzer. The resulting tokens are then categorized creating buckets of similarly formatted text values. This aggregation works best with machine generated text like system logs. blood test for cats costWebApr 2, 2024 · Improving aggregation performance in Elasticsearch Even though Elasticsearch is most known for its full text search capabilities, many use cases also take advantage of another very powerful feature Elasticsearch delivers out of the box: the aggregations framework. Aggregations are used everywhere in Kibana. blood test for cat scratch diseaseWebAug 23, 2024 · Try with an aggregation like that: { "aggs": { "resellers": { "nested": { "path": "doc.sample_ids" }, "aggs": { "sum_values": { "sum": { "script": { "lang": "painless", "source": "Float.parseFloat (doc ['doc.sample_ids.value.keyword'].value)" } } } } } } } With a data like this : """"35.6"""" At first, you should clean your datas. blood test for c difficileWebNov 13, 2024 · Here we explain how to do searches in ElasticSearch (ES). ES has a seemingly endless list of search options, which can seem overwhelming. So we will start with some simple examples and build from there. ... Basically ElasticSearch is saying that doing aggregation on the text fields would require calculating extra data and holding … free diabetic supplies breeze 2WebMar 21, 2024 · The wildcard type was introduced in Elasticsearch version 7.9. Text vs. Match Only Text. The type “match_only_text” is very similar to “text” but it saves disk space by sacrificing granular scoring. Read more about it here. Code samples. Create a multi-field mapping to enable all string types on the field message: free diabetic stuff ukWebCategorize text aggregation. A multi-bucket aggregation that groups semi-structured text into buckets. Each text field is re-analyzed using a custom analyzer. The resulting … free diabetic supplies and insulinWebApr 22, 2024 · Combine Aggregations & Filters in ElasticSearch Rating: 4 10835 A natural extension to aggregation scoping is filtering. Because the aggregation operates in the context of the query scope, any filter … blood test for chemical exposure